Did the same last June, bought from Jim Parisi at Marshall Ford (O'Fallon. MO) for $1K under and drove it back to CA via I70. Had a blast staying with friends in Denver then spending two days in Moab, UT. Scenery was fantastic and a KS State Trooper even stopped by to say hello and check out my new truck. I had pulled off the hwy to get pics of the new truck. One thing my local DMV office insisted on was the weight certificate (even though I gave them the original MSO). But it only took 10 mins and was $11.00 so no big deal. Beware that CA DMV charges a penalty if you don't register a vehicle purchased out of state within like 10 to 20 days (check me on this it's been awhile) but a significant penalty would have been charged had I waited for my appointment (which was 6 weeks out) rather than standing in line earlier. Would do this again in a heartbeat and OP is correct most all new vehicles are 50 state emissions compliant these days...Pic of my 1st off road adventure near Monument Valley, AZ.
